#include using namespace std; int main() { int N,M; cin >> N>>M; vector>> v(M); for(auto& a : v) cin >> a.second.first >> a.first >> a.second.second >> a.first; sort(v.begin(), v.end(), greater>>()); vector h(N); for(int i = 0; i < N; i++) { h[i] = i+1; } for(auto a : v) { swap(h[a.second.first-1], h[a.second.second-1]); } for(auto a : h) { cout << a << '\n'; } }